Start With Licensing and Player Protection

Regulation is the foundation of a credible casino. A licensed operator should clearly display its company details, regulatory authority, licence number, and terms for deposits, withdrawals, bonuses, and account verification. These details should be easy to find rather than hidden behind vague statements.

Licensing does not guarantee that every player will enjoy the same experience, yet it establishes minimum standards. Regulated casinos are generally expected to protect customer funds, apply identity checks, publish fair-play information, and offer tools for safer gambling. Look for deposit limits, time-outs, self-exclusion options, and reality checks before creating an account.

  • Confirm the licence through the regulator’s public register.
  • Read the privacy policy before sharing personal information.
  • Check whether customer funds receive any stated protection.
  • Review responsible gambling tools and age-verification procedures.

Read Bonus Terms Before Opting In

Promotions can add value, but the headline figure is rarely the complete offer. A bonus may require a specified wagering amount before winnings become withdrawable. Other conditions can include a maximum bet, restricted games, minimum odds, a deposit limit, or a short expiry period.

For example, a 100% match bonus sounds attractive until the player discovers that the deposit and bonus must be wagered many times. Some casinos also separate bonus funds from cash balances, which can affect the order in which money is played. Read the full promotional rules and avoid accepting an offer that is difficult to understand.

Questions to Ask About a Promotion

  • How much must be wagered before withdrawal is permitted?
  • Which games contribute fully, partially, or not at all?
  • Does the offer have a maximum qualifying deposit?
  • What happens if the player withdraws before completing the conditions?
  • Are winnings capped or subject to additional restrictions?

Assess Games, Fairness, and Usability

Reputable casinos normally work with recognised software providers and explain how games are tested. Random number generators should be independently audited, while live casino tables should provide clear information about studio operations, limits, and game rules.

Usability also affects the quality of a platform. Menus should make it simple to find favourite games, view balances, access terms, and contact support. A responsive mobile site or well-maintained application should not sacrifice essential account features. Before depositing, test the lobby, search function, cashier, and help centre.

Game choice should be judged by quality rather than quantity. A large catalogue may include hundreds of near-identical titles, whereas a smaller selection from reputable studios can offer better variety. Check return-to-player information where available, remembering that theoretical percentages describe long-term mathematical expectations, not guaranteed results in an individual session.

Payments, Verification, and Withdrawal Expectations

Payment transparency is one of the clearest signs of an organised operator. The cashier should show available methods, minimum and maximum limits, fees, and estimated processing times. Deposits are often instant, while withdrawals may take longer because the casino must complete security and identity checks.

Players can reduce delays by using payment details registered in their own name and submitting clear documents when requested. Common verification materials include proof of identity, address, and payment ownership. Never create multiple accounts to claim a bonus, as this can trigger restrictions or cancellation under standard terms.

Responsible Play Should Shape the Decision

Casino games are paid entertainment, not a dependable income source. Set a budget before playing and treat it as an expense that can be lost. A session should end when the planned time or spending limit has been reached, regardless of whether results are positive or negative.

  • Use fixed deposit and session limits.
  • Keep gambling separate from essential household money.
  • Do not chase losses or borrow funds to continue playing.
  • Take regular breaks and monitor changes in mood or behaviour.
  • Use self-exclusion or professional support if gambling stops feeling manageable.
